On Sat, August 12, 2006 9:41, Paul Alfille said: > Two suggestions (and it works under Ubuntu abd DSL -- both debian based). > > 1. Run as root. The problem could be usb permissions. I'm sure there is a > udev solution (that's the modern hotplug approach) but I haven't figured > it > out yet. You could always run owserver as root and connect to it with > non-root owfs or owhttpd. > > 2. Run with error logging: > owfs -u /mnt/owfs --foreground --error_level=9 > you'll get lots of data, but the very start is the adapter connections. > > Also, usb isn't like serial, there is no dedicated number. -u2 just means > the 2nd enumerated DS9490r.
Also, make sure you do 'modprobe fuse' first...
